本文將指導您如何在Eclipse中創(chuàng)建一個基于Maven的Web項目。通過本文,您將學會如何使用Eclipse和Maven進行Web開發(fā),從而快速搭建一個簡單的Web應用。
準備工作
在開始之前,請確保您已經安裝了Eclipse IDE for Java Developers和Maven。如果尚未安裝,可以訪問以下鏈接進行下載和安裝:
? Eclipse官方下載地址:https://www.eclipse.org/downloads/packages/
? Maven官方下載地址:https://maven.apache.org/download.cgi
步驟1:創(chuàng)建一個新的Java項目
在Eclipse中,點擊菜單欄的“File” > “New” > “Java Project”,然后輸入項目名稱,例如“My Maven Web Project”。接著,選擇“Dynamic Web Module”作為項目類型,然后點擊“Finish”按鈕創(chuàng)建項目。
步驟2:添加Maven依賴
在項目的根目錄下,右鍵點擊“pom.xml”文件,選擇“Import” > “General” > “Existing Maven Projects”,然后點擊“Next”按鈕。在彈出的對話框中,點擊“Add Repository”按鈕,然后點擊“Next”按鈕。接下來,選擇“Maven Repository”下的“User Settings”,然后輸入您的Maven用戶名和密碼(如果需要)。最后,點擊“Finish”按鈕完成導入過程。
您需要為項目添加Web模塊所需的依賴。右鍵點擊項目的根目錄,選擇“New” > “Other”,然后在彈出的對話框中選擇“Maven Webapp” > “Maven Webapp (default)”,點擊“Next”按鈕。在“Goals and Options”頁面,勾選“Create web application project”,然后點擊“ Finish ”按鈕。這將在項目根目錄下生成一個名為“webapp”的新文件夾。
步驟3:配置Web服務器
為了運行Web應用,您需要配置一個Web服務器。這里我們以Tomcat為例進行介紹。首先,下載并安裝Tomcat服務器:https://tomcat.apache.org/download-90.cgi
在Eclipse中,右鍵點擊項目名(包括“.project”和“src”文件夾),選擇“Properties”。在彈出的對話框中,選擇“Deployment Assembly”,然后點擊右側的“New”按鈕。在彈出的對話框中,點擊左側的“Artifact”,然后選擇剛剛創(chuàng)建的“webapp”文件夾作為構件。在右側的列表中,選擇Tomcat的“war”部署類型,并設置輸出目錄為Tomcat的"webapps"目錄。最后,點擊“OK”按鈕保存配置。
步驟4:運行Web應用
您已經成功創(chuàng)建了一個基于Maven的Web項目。要運行Web應用,請打開Eclipse的終端窗口(位于屏幕底部),然后輸入以下命令:
mvn clean install
執(zhí)行此命令后,Maven將編譯并打包Web應用。完成后,您可以在Tomcat的"webapps"目錄下找到生成的".war"文件。雙擊該文件啟動Web應用。默認情況下,應用將在"http://localhost:8080/MyMavenWebProject"地址上運行。
您已經成功地在Eclipse中創(chuàng)建了一個基于Maven的Web項目,并成功運行了該Web應用。接下來,您可以開始開發(fā)您的Web應用程序了!